Finished goods that are produced for further processing are subject to incoming and outgoing inspection. Many widely differing materials can be combined. The analytical flexibility available in the multi-base configurations makes the stationary metal analyzer an important partner for the documentation and storage of the measured products per work step and process. Depending on the analytical requirements, the
SPECTROLAB
, tthe
SPECTROMAXx
, and the
SPECTROCHECK
are ideal for this task.
The
SPECTROTEST
,
SPECTROPORT
and
SPECTRO xSORT
mobile analyzers are designed especially for location-independent operation. The mobile metal analyzers can be employed on site in receiving for incoming goods inspection to ensure the correct delivery of materials and, depending on the material, to control further processing steps or to conduct the respective finished goods inspection before shipment.
X-ray fluorescence analysis is excellently suited to the determination of coatings on aluminum and steel sheets. Depending on the application, the
SPECTRO XEPOS
, the
SPECTROSCOUT
or the
SPECTRO MIDEX
can be used. In addition to the analysis of coatings, the concentrations of coating baths are also monitored with XRF.
